An empty beaker is weighed and found to weigh 23.1 g. Some potassium chloride is then added to the beaker and weighed again. The

second weight is 24.862 g. What is the mass of the potassium chloride
Chemistry
1 answer:
GuDViN [60]3 years ago
8 0

Answer:Mass of Potassium chloride =1.762g

Explanation:

Mass of empty beaker = 23.100 g

Mass of beaker with Potassium chloride = 24.862g

Mass of Potassium chloride = Final weight - initial weight = Mass of beaker with Potassium chloride  - Mass of empty beaker = 24.862-23.100 = 1.762g

Does the temperature of the solvent (water) affect the rate of dissolving?​
gregori [183]
Yes. Heating up the solvent gives the molecules more kinetic energy. The more rapid motion means that the solvent molecules collide with the solute with greater frequency and the collisions occur with more force. Both factors increase the rate at which the solute dissolves.
